Investors looking to achieve exposure to specific sectors of the U.S. economy often turn to S&P 500 sector ETFs. These funds provide a efficient way to participate in a particular industry, such as technology, healthcare, or energy. Analyzing the performance of these ETFs is crucial for investors seeking to construct well-diversified portfolios that correspond with their investment goals.
Current market conditions have had a significant impact on the returns of S&P 500 sector ETFs. For instance, the technology sector has experienced robust growth, while sectors like energy and materials have faced difficulties.
- Factors influencing sector ETF performance include economic indicators, interest rate changes, governmental developments, and individual news.
- It's important for investors to undertake their own investigation before committing capital to S&P 500 sector ETFs.

Leveraging in Sector ETFs for Targeted Growth and Diversification
Sector Exchange Traded Funds (ETFs) present a compelling avenue in investors targeting both targeted growth and diversification within their portfolios. By concentrating on specific industries, such as technology, healthcare, or energy, investors can amplify their exposure amongst sectors exhibiting strong potential. Moreover, ETFs offer a budget-friendly way to achieve diversification, as they typically contain a basket of securities within a particular sector. This approach helps to mitigate risk by spreading investments across multiple companies, thus creating a more robust portfolio.
Finally, investing in sector ETFs presents a valuable tool for investors desiring to tailor their portfolios aligned with their specific investment goals. Nonetheless, it's crucial to conduct thorough research and grasp the risks and benefits associated of each sector before implementing any investment decisions.
